What is the Personal Financial Statement Form?

The Personal Financial Statement Form is a vital document used to assess an individual's financial condition, focusing on their assets, liabilities, and income. This form plays a crucial role in evaluating creditworthiness, especially for loans and credit applications. Financial institutions, such as banks, typically require this form to better understand an applicant's financial stability and to make informed lending decisions.
This form requires detailed disclosures of personal and business assets as well as liabilities. All applicants should accurately report their financial history to support their loan requests, which ultimately aids in determining their eligibility for credit products.

Key Features of the Personal Financial Statement Form

The Personal Financial Statement Form contains several notable features that users should familiarize themselves with. It includes sections dedicated to listing assets, liabilities, cash income, and expenses.
  • Detailed fields for tracking various types of financial data.
  • Instructions for accurately inputting information.
  • Signature requirements for both applicants and joint applicants.
These features ensure that users can provide complete and precise financial disclosures, which are critical in the assessment process by lenders.
